First let me say, as soon as we got into the elevator there was a weird smell.
Now the hotel did smell old, but there was something else in the air. It got
worse when we walked down the hallways to our room and our room was no better.
It tickled all our noses and I couldn’t stop sneezing. We left our bags and
headed to the closest store to buy air fresheners. When we came back to our
room, someone else walking down the hallway also mentioned the smell. We told
them we got room sprays and they said they would have to do the same.
Now besides the place smelling funny, the tub was moldy, the beds were concaved
and made it very uncomfortable to sleep in.
The hotel might have upgraded their lobby to give “appearances” that it’s a nice
place, but it’s not. Luckily we were hardly in our room.
We also found out what the weird smell was….BUG Spray.

Lobby and rooms had been updated - but putting new throw pillows doesn't hid the
fact that this is a dated hotel. If you look past the "newer" accessories, you
can see they are already a bit worn. The courtyard was lovely though. Hallway
carpet was absolutely disgusting - many unidentifiable stains. Rooms were fine
for the most part - the removable things were already worn, but not nearly as
old as the tile and wall-paper. A number of creepy crawlies found in the
bathroom set me off a bit - housekeeping came up and sprayed saying they were
coming in through the AC unit. They did not offer any sort of compensation for
the bugs. Only one PC in their business center, but it worked. I did hear
another guest complain they had no wi-fi in their room and the front desk staff
offered no compensation for that either. You get what you pay for in a high-rent
district.

Located in a nice, near freeway access area. Easy drive to stores and
restaurants. about 3 to 4 miles away and w/ variety)
Rooms were VERY clean and quiet. Staff was friendly and extremely helpful.
We needed directions on two separate days during our stay and when we asked the
front desk...they printed out maps and directions both times which was very
helpful because we forgot our GPS unit.
Only down sides were; the rooms didn't have a wi-fi connection (and was plug in
only) and the pool wasn't very clean. My son and nieces only wanted to swim in
it for 15 minutes.
We had the complementary breakfast around 9 a.m. and it was pretty busy at the
time, BUT the best part about it was- the dinning area was huge and spacious and
had more than enough seating and tables for everyone. Staff was also on top of
keeping the breakfast items well stocked for guests. Not a "stingy" hotel,
unlike some other hotels.

Was very disappointed, We choose the Coast Hotel because it advertised with free
Internet and because of the pool. The Internet was only available in public
rooms and the pool was not the Clean indoor /outdoor pool that was advertised on
their website. The housecleaning staff was extremely slow as well or room was
not cleaned until approx 4 pm daily. The breakfast was poor and they ran out of
food each day by 9:30 am.......Kutos to the kitchen however because if you
ordered off the menu the food was wonderful!!!

I booked a room for one night, July 27, 2011 at the Coast Hotel through
Priceline. When I arrived around midnite from the airport, I was told that
Priceline had overbooked the hotel, and there were no rooms left. I was given a
mapquest sheet with driving directions to the Quality Inn in Renton, WA, a
nearby suburb, and told that Coast Hotel had booked me into the Quality Inn for
one night at no charge. I was told it would be a 10 minute cab ride. It took 55
minutes, because the taxi driver got lost. I had to pay for the taxi ride
myself, $30.00, and also the taxi ride back to the Coast Hotel the next day, to
collect reimbursement for the taxi rides. The Coast Hotel staff seemed quite
embarrassed and somewhat apologetic the next day, but not overly apologetic.
Several other people who had booked the Coast Hotel that same night were also
turned away and sent to the Quality Inn in Renton. I found that out from the
front desk staff at the Quality Inn. So if you will be arriving late on your
trip to Bellevue, do not book at the Coast Hotel, or you will risk being sent to
a different hotel.
